The factors for looking for an expert hacker are diverse, ranging from corporate security to private digital recovery. Below are the most common services provided by top ethical hackers.
1. Penetration Testing (Pen Testing)
Businesses Hire Professional Hacker hackers to carry out regulated attacks on their own networks. The goal is to identify vulnerabilities before a wrongdoer can exploit them. This is a proactive step essential for compliance in markets like financing and health care.
2. Property and Password Recovery
Digital "lockouts" befall numerous individuals. Whether it is a lost password to a tradition encrypted drive or a forgotten secret to a cryptocurrency wallet, specialized recovery experts use brute-force tools and cryptographic analysis to restore access for the rightful owner.
3. Digital Forensics
After an information breach or a circumstances of online fraud, digital forensic specialists are hired to "follow the breadcrumbs." They determine how the breach happened, what data was compromised, and who the wrongdoer may be, frequently providing evidence utilized in legal proceedings.
4. Vulnerability Research
Big tech companies run "Bug Bounty Programs," essentially hiring the worldwide hacking neighborhood to discover defects in their software application. Platforms like HackerOne and Bugcrowd facilitate these interactions, paying countless dollars for considerable discoveries.

Yes, offered the intent is legal and you have the authority over the system being accessed. Employing an ethical hacker to secure your own company or recuperate your own information is completely legal. Employing somebody to access a system you do not own without permission is prohibited.

What is a "Bug Bounty"?
A bug bounty is a reward offered by companies to people who discover and report software application vulnerabilities. It is a method for business to hire countless hackers all at once in a controlled, legal, and helpful way.
